A demanding career, Fashion Designing, entails utilising artistic skills to come up with unique innovative design concepts for apparels and/or lifestyle accessories on a regular basis for then only you will be able to create successful collection season after season. While Fashion Designing as a discipline is known more for fame, wealth and glamour, it actually entails lots of hard work, since you are responsible for the entire production process right from getting insights through research of the end customers, understanding their preferences, comprehending the market dynamics, the techniques, material and fashion trends etc. to using these insights to conceptualize designs to budgeting to developing prototypes to analyse the throw of cloth to its final outcome, where you get involved in marketing, retailing & sales to ensure revenue. The insights drawn through research also help you in predicting the design concepts for the upcoming season that will entice the target audience and hence be a success. Alternatively, if the collection is a failure, then he should be adept in analysing the reasons and make amends.

Duties of Fashion Designers
- Research, analyse & study fashion & market trends
- Networking with other fashion designers to understand the latest in fashion
- Conceptualize a design theme for the season along with relevant sketches
- Predict designs that will draw the targeted customer
- Utilize computer-aided design (CAD) programs to generate the requisite apparel designs
- Visiting exhibitions, trade shows and the manufacturers to understand the latest techniques, identify the appropriate samples of fabric/material, textures, colours, patterns etc.
- Develop apt prototypes
- Collaborate with designers & teams from different departments as well as stakeholders so as to make the collection a success
- Showcase the collection at various fashion and/or trade shows, thereby facilitating interest and orders for the collection
- Collaborate with Merchandisers to market designs at retail level
- Build & maintain relationships with stakeholders, vendors, suppliers, buyers and models
Salary Offered on completion of Masters in Fashion Designing:
Average salary for a fresher can be between Rs. 2 lakhs to Rs. 4.3 lakhs per annum depending on the kind of company or the brand you joined, the city you are working in and the college from where you did your masters. People with over 10 years’ experience can earn on an average anywhere between Rs. 30 lakhs to Rs. 35 lakhs per annum, but then it also depends on your fashion designing skills besides your communication & networking skills. The highest salary can go up to Rs. 60 Lakhs per annum. However, the top celebrity fashion designers like Sabyasachi, Manish Malhotra, Ritu Kumar etc. can earn up to Rs. 10 crores per annum.
